RIT envisioned a plan where students satisfied specified learning incomes in an outcomes-based, integrated, new General Education Framework. TaskStream's Assessment Management System enabled RIT to introduce an enterprise-wide solution that would support meaningful, manageable, and sustainable assessment. The Director of Student Learning Outcomes Assessment and Assessment Management System Coordinator provide an overview of RIT General Education assessment and the design and implementation of the assessment management system.
This 90 minute session offered by the Student Learning Outcomes Assessment (SLOA) Office offers an overview of Institutional Effectiveness (IE) at RIT and will review key elements of the IE Map. This interactive session will examine Unit goals and outcomes (new or existing) for the Academic Affairs' Living Learning Communities and will serve as a basis for outlining outcomes with data sources and measures. Participants will begin to develop an IE Map designed to assess student outcomes for each of RIT's 2011-2012 Living Learning Communities.
Starting to work on your course outlines for the semester conversion process? This workshop is designed to help create or refine course-level learning goals and student learning outcomes.
This 90 minute session offered by Student Learning Outcomes Assessment (SLOA) takes you through a structured process to create course learning goals as the basis for course (re)design. The workshop includes peer sharing and collaboration as you develop or refine learning goals and student learning outcomes for one of your own courses.
Interested in developing or redesigning course-level assessments for your semester course?
During this 90 minute session facilitated by the Student Learning Outcomes Assessment (SLOA) office, you will review a variety of course assessment options and best practices in matching assessments to course-level learning goals and student learning outcomes. One of the goals of the session is for participants to develop an assessment to measure a course goal and student learning outcome. Bring one course outline form with you which includes course goals and student learning outcomes, and one assignment from the course.
